The Israel Defense Forces confirmed Saturday that missiles were launched from Iran toward Israel, triggering sirens in multiple regions. "A short while ago, sirens sounded in several areas across Israel following the identification of missiles launched from Iran toward the State of Israel," the IDF said in a statement.

Israel launches airstrike in Gaza after 5 soldiers wounded in militant attack
Israel said it has launched an airstrike on a Hamas militant in southern Gaza in retaliation for an attack earlier in the day that wounded five Israeli soldiers. The strike late Wednesday was the latest test for a fragile ceasefire that has mostly held up since early October,
